E-waste, or electronic waste, is any discarded electrical or electronic device. Improper disposal of e-waste poses significant risks to the environment and human health. Many of these gadgets contain hazardous materials such as lead, mercury, and cadmium, which can seep into the soil and water, contaminating them. E-waste occupies a significant portion of landfill space, resulting in increased pollution.

Toxic materials from these devices can leach into the soil, affecting plant life and, subsequently, the animals that consume these plants. Polluted water bodies can lead to dead zones where aquatic life cannot survive.

Exposure to toxic substances can lead to serious health issues, including respiratory problems, neurological disorders, and even cancer. Those who work in informal recycling sectors in developing countries are particularly at risk due to inadequate safety measures.

 

Steps for Proper Disposal of Electrical Equipment

Check if the item is repairable, as fixing minor issues can extend its life and reduce waste. Simple repairs can often render a device useful again, saving resources and money.

For devices that store personal information, such as computers and mobile phones, data security is paramount. Back up important data to another device or cloud service. After ensuring your data is securely stored, perform a factory reset or use specialized software to completely erase all personal information. This step protects your privacy and ensures that your data does not fall into the wrong hands.

Many manufacturers offer take-back or recycling programs for their products. These programs allow consumers to return old or unused electronics, which the manufacturers then recycle or refurbish. This ensures the devices are handled safely and responsibly. Check the manufacturer’s website or contact customer service to learn about the specific programs they offer.

Local recycling centers are equipped to handle and process e-waste properly. These facilities follow regulatory standards to recycle materials safely. Locate a nearby e-waste recycling center, drop off your old electronics, and they will take care of the recycling process. Many municipalities have designated days for e-waste collection, making it convenient for residents to dispose of their electronics responsibly.

If your electronic equipment is still in good working condition, consider donating it to schools, non-profits, or community centers. Many organizations rely on donated electronics to support their operations and serve the community. Donating usable items extends their life cycle and helps those in need, making a positive impact on society.

Certified e-waste recyclers follow stringent guidelines to ensure safe and eco-friendly recycling processes. Look for recyclers with certifications such as R2 (Responsible Recycling) or e-Stewards. These certifications indicate that the recycler meets high standards for environmental and worker safety. 

 

The Do’s and Don’ts of E-Waste Disposal

Familiarize yourself with local regulations to ensure you are disposing of e-waste legally and responsibly. Many municipalities provide resources and guidelines on how to manage e-waste.

Electrical Equipment Dispose Some electronic devices contain hazardous materials like lead, mercury, and cadmium. Components such as batteries, fluorescent lights, and CRT monitors need special handling. Make sure these components are identified and separately disposed of in accordance with local guidelines.

Spread awareness about the importance of proper e-waste disposal within your community. Inform others about the environmental and health risks associated with improper e-waste management and encourage responsible disposal practices.

Avoid discarding electronic devices in regular household trash. Always use designated e-waste disposal methods.

Unless you have the necessary training, avoid dismantling electronic devices yourself. Improper handling can lead to exposure to hazardous materials and pose safety risks. Leave dismantling to professionals who have the proper tools and knowledge.

When purchasing new electrical equipment, do not overlook the importance of opting for eco-friendly products. Choose devices made from recyclable materials and those that are energy-efficient. Supporting sustainable products contributes to reducing the overall environmental impact.

 

Policies and Regulations Affecting E-Waste

The Basel Convention is an international treaty aimed at reducing the movement of hazardous waste between nations. It specifically addresses the export and import of e-waste from developed to less developed countries, ensuring that hazardous waste is managed in an environmentally sound manner. Signatory countries are required to adopt measures to minimize e-waste generation and promote recycling and recovery.

The EU has established comprehensive regulations to manage e-waste through the Waste Electrical and Electronic Equipment (WEEE) Directive. The WEEE Directive mandates that producers are responsible for the collection, treatment, and recycling of e-waste. It sets targets for the recovery and recycling rates and requires member states to establish collection systems for e-waste. The Restriction of Hazardous Substances (RoHS) Directive restricts the use of certain hazardous materials in electrical and electronic equipment.

In the United States, e-waste regulations vary by state, as there is no federal law specifically governing e-waste disposal. States such as California, New York, and Washington have enacted e-waste recycling laws that require manufacturers to fund recycling programs. These programs ensure the proper collection and recycling of end-of-life electronic products. The Electronic Waste Recycling Act of 2003 in California, for instance, established an advanced recycling fee to fund e-waste recycling.

Japan’s Laws for the Recycling of Specified Kinds of Home Appliances require manufacturers to take back and recycle specific types of home appliances, including televisions, refrigerators, washing machines, and air conditioners. The law imposes recycling fees on consumers and mandates manufacturers to establish and maintain recycling facilities. Japan’s Home Appliance Recycling Law ensures the efficient recovery of valuable materials and encourages resource conservation.

China has implemented regulations to manage e-waste through the Regulation on the Administration of the Recovery and Disposal of Waste Electrical and Electronic Products. This regulation establishes requirements for the collection, transportation, and treatment of e-waste, promoting environmentally sound management practices. China enforces the Extended Producer Responsibility (EPR) system, which obliges manufacturers to bear the responsibility for the entire lifecycle of their products, including disposal.

Extended Producer Responsibility (EPR) is a policy approach where manufacturers are obligated to take responsibility for the entire lifecycle of their products, including end-of-life disposal. EPR policies incentivize manufacturers to design products that are easier to recycle and have a minimal environmental impact. By shifting the responsibility from consumers to producers, EPR policies aim to enhance resource efficiency and reduce e-waste.

EPR policies are implemented through various mechanisms, including take-back programs, recycling targets, and eco-design incentives. Manufacturers may be required to establish collection and recycling systems, finance the treatment of e-waste, or adhere to specific design standards that facilitate recycling. EPR policies encourage innovation and sustainable product design, promoting a circular economy.

Non-compliance with e-waste regulations can result in penalties, including fines, sanctions, and legal actions. Governments enforce these penalties to ensure that manufacturers, recyclers, and consumers adhere to proper e-waste management practices. Compliance with regulations protects businesses from legal and financial repercussions.
